28 June 2019 | Story Xolisa Mnukwa
UFS Thought Leader series
The 2019 UFS Thought-Leader Series explores techniques of renewal and solutions for economic growth and entrepreneurship as an instrument of development for South Africa.

The University of the Free State (UFS), in cooperation with Vrye Weekblad, will present the second consecutive Thought-Leader Series as part of the Vrystaat Arts Festival on Thursday 4 July in the Economic and Management Science Auditorium (EBW Auditorium) on the UFS Bloemfontein Campus.

As a higher-education institution, the UFS deems itself responsible for contributing to local and national public discourses by assembling industry experts to deliberate on imperative topics that affect students, the broader community, and the country in one way or another. 

Topic of discussion for 2019 Thought-leader series 

In 2019, the UFS Thought-Leader series unpacks Economic Growth and Entrepreneurship for a Growing South Africa in the form of two concentrated panel discussions which will address the questions, ‘How can we fix the South African economy and create jobs?’ and ‘How can we establish a pro-youth entrepreneurship strategy for South Africa?’ respectively.

Expert panellists to discuss economic growth and entrepreneurship

Editor of the Vrye Weekblad, Max du Preez, will be facilitating discussions between panellists. The following panellists will participate in the first panel: Executive Director at the Centre for Politics and Research and political commentator, Prince Mashele; Vice-Dean (Strategic Projects) of the UFS Faculty of Economic and Management Sciences, Prof Philippe Burger; Director and Chief Economist at the Efficient Group, Dawie Roodt; and Chief Economist at Investec, Annabel Bishop.  

Chief Executive Officer at Harambee Youth Employment Accelerator, Maryana Iskander; Senior Banker at the Rand Merchant Bank, David Abbey; and Head of the UFS Department of Business Management, Prof Brownhilder Neneh, will form part of the second panel.

Dr Abdon Atangana cements his research globally by solving fractional calculus problem
2014-12-03

 

Dr Abdon Atangana

To publish 29 papers in respected international journals – and all of that in one year – is no mean feat. Postdoctoral researcher Abdon Atangana at the Institute for Groundwater Studies at the University of the Free State (UFS) reached this mark by October 2014, shortly before his 29th birthday.

His latest paper, ‘Modelling the Advancement of the Impurities and the Melted Oxygen concentration within the Scope of Fractional Calculus’, has been accepted for publication by the International Journal of Non-Linear Mechanics.

In previously-published research he solved a problem in the field of fractional calculus by introducing a fractional derivative called ‘Beta-derivative’ and its anti-derivative called ‘Atangana-Beta integral’, thereby cementing his research in this field.

Dr Atangana, originally from Cameroon, received his PhD in Geohydrology at the UFS in 2013. His research interests include:
• the theory of fractional calculus;
• modelling real world problems with fractional order derivatives;
• applications of fractional calculus;
• analytical methods for partial differential equations;
• analytical methods for ordinary differential equations;
• numerical methods for partial and ordinary differential equations; and
• iterative methods and uncertainties modelling.

Dr Atangana says that, “Applied mathematics can be regarded as the bridge between theory and practice. The use of mathematical tools for solving real world problems is as old as creation itself. As written in the book Genesis ‘And God saw the light, that it was good; and divided the light from the darkness’, the word division appears here as the well-known method of separation of variables, this method is usually employed to solve a class of linear partial differential equations”.

“A mathematical model is a depiction of a system using mathematical concepts and language. The procedure of developing a mathematical model is termed mathematical modelling. Mathematical models are used not only in natural sciences, but also in social sciences such as economics, psychology, sociology and political sciences. These models help to explain systems and to study the effects of different components, and to make predictions about behaviours.”
